From e3af3dc5b9f3f9c70d3c5523b1a7300247b1377c Mon Sep 17 00:00:00 2001 From: Folio Mikael <milykim@hotmail.fr> Date: Thu, 22 Feb 2024 06:39:18 +0100 Subject: [PATCH] Internationalisation --- .../configurer_design_system_admin.html | 102 +++++++++++------- .../prive/css/dsfrconfiguration.css | 6 +- 2 files changed, 67 insertions(+), 41 deletions(-) diff --git a/design_system_admin/formulaires/configurer_design_system_admin.html b/design_system_admin/formulaires/configurer_design_system_admin.html index 477f2d7..93f79d1 100644 --- a/design_system_admin/formulaires/configurer_design_system_admin.html +++ b/design_system_admin/formulaires/configurer_design_system_admin.html @@ -94,24 +94,24 @@ [(#CONFIG_VALUE{_masquer_langue}|=={non}|oui) [(#CONFIG_VALUE{nombre_de_langue}|>{1}|oui) <div class="tabs"> - <div role="tablist" aria-labelledby="tablist-1" class="automatic"> - - - + <div role="tablist" aria-labelledby="tablist-1" class="automatic"> <button id="tab-1" type="button" role="tab" aria-selected="true" aria-controls="tabpanel-1"> - <span class="focus">Maria Ahlefeldt</span> + <span class="focus"><img src="[(#CHEMIN{prive/themes/spip/images/langues/#CONFIG_VALUE{value_langue_1}.png})]" width="21"> #CONFIG_VALUE{langue_1}</span> </button> <button id="tab-2" type="button" role="tab" aria-selected="false" aria-controls="tabpanel-2" tabindex="-1"> - <span class="focus">Carl Andersen</span> - </button> - <button id="tab-3" type="button" role="tab" aria-selected="false" aria-controls="tabpanel-3" tabindex="-1"> - <span class="focus">Ida da Fonseca</span> + <span class="focus"><img src="[(#CHEMIN{prive/themes/spip/images/langues/#CONFIG_VALUE{value_langue_2}.png})]" width="21"> #CONFIG_VALUE{langue_2}</span> </button> - <button id="tab-4" type="button" role="tab" aria-selected="false" aria-controls="tabpanel-4" tabindex="-1"> - <span class="focus">Peter Müller</span> - </button> - </div> - + [(#CONFIG_VALUE{nombre_de_langue}|>{2}|oui) + <button id="tab-3" type="button" role="tab" aria-selected="false" aria-controls="tabpanel-3" tabindex="-1"> + <span class="focus"><img src="[(#CHEMIN{prive/themes/spip/images/langues/#CONFIG_VALUE{value_langue_3}.png})]" width="21"> #CONFIG_VALUE{langue_3}</span> + </button> + ] + [(#CONFIG_VALUE{nombre_de_langue}|>{3}|oui) + <button id="tab-4" type="button" role="tab" aria-selected="false" aria-controls="tabpanel-4" tabindex="-1"> + <span class="focus"><img src="[(#CHEMIN{prive/themes/spip/images/langues/#CONFIG_VALUE{value_langue_4}.png})]" width="21"> #CONFIG_VALUE{langue_4}</span> + </button> + ] + </div> <div id="tabpanel-1" role="tabpanel" tabindex="0" aria-labelledby="tab-1"> ] ] @@ -141,27 +141,48 @@ [(#CONFIG_VALUE{_masquer_langue}|=={non}|oui) [(#CONFIG_VALUE{nombre_de_langue}|>{1}|oui) </div> + <div id="tabpanel-2" role="tabpanel" tabindex="0" aria-labelledby="tab-2" class="is-hidden"> - <p> - Carl Joachim Andersen (29 April 1847 – 7 May 1909) was a Danish flutist, conductor and composer born in Copenhagen, son of the flutist Christian Joachim Andersen. - Both as a virtuoso and as composer of flute music, he is considered one of the best of his time. - He was considered to be a tough leader and teacher and demanded as such a lot from his orchestras but through that style he reached a high level. - </p> - </div> - <div id="tabpanel-3" role="tabpanel" tabindex="0" aria-labelledby="tab-3" class="is-hidden"> - <p> - Ida Henriette da Fonseca (July 27, 1802 – July 6, 1858) was a Danish opera singer and composer. - Ida Henriette da Fonseca was the daughter of Abraham da Fonseca (1776–1849) and Marie Sofie Kiærskou (1784–1863). - She and her sister Emilie da Fonseca were students of Giuseppe Siboni, choir master of the Opera in Copenhagen. - She was given a place at the royal Opera alongside her sister the same year she debuted in 1827. - </p> - </div> - <div id="tabpanel-4" role="tabpanel" tabindex="0" aria-labelledby="tab-4" class="is-hidden"> - <p> - Peter Erasmus Lange-Müller (1 December 1850 – 26 February 1926) was a Danish composer and pianist. - His compositional style was influenced by Danish folk music and by the work of Robert Schumann; Johannes Brahms; and his Danish countrymen, including J.P.E. Hartmann. - </p> + <div class="editer-groupe grp_title_onglet_navigateur"> + <div class="editer editer_title_onglet_navigateur obligatoire saisie_input editer_even"> + <label class="editer-label" for="champ_title_onglet_navigateur_#CONFIG_VALUE{langue_2}">Titre dans l'onglet<span class="obligatoire"></span></label> + <input type="text" name="title_onglet_navigateur_#CONFIG_VALUE{langue_2}" class="text" id="champ_title_onglet_navigateur_#CONFIG_VALUE{langue_2}" value="#CONFIG_VALUE{title_onglet_navigateur_#CONFIG_VALUE{langue_2}}" placeholder="Champ obligatoire. Saisir le titre qui apparaît dans l'onglet du navigateur"> + <button class="liste_de_lien questionmark_header" type="button" title="Afficher la fenêtre d'aide" data-parent="grp_title_onglet_navigateur" data-fille="aide_title_onglet_navigateur"><span class="bold colorblack">?</span></button> + </div> + </div> + <div class="editer-groupe grp_meta_description"> + <div class="editer editer_meta_description obligatoire saisie_textarea editer_odd"> + <label class="editer-label" for="champ_meta_description_#CONFIG_VALUE{langue_2}">Méta-description<span class="obligatoire"></span></label> + <textarea name="meta_description_#CONFIG_VALUE{langue_2}" id="champ_meta_description_#CONFIG_VALUE{langue_2}" rows="6" cols="33" placeholder="Champ obligatoire. Saisir le texte de la méta intitulée Meta-description dans le header">#CONFIG_VALUE{meta_description_#CONFIG_VALUE{langue_2}}</textarea> + <button class="liste_de_lien questionmark_header" type="button" title="Afficher la fenêtre d'aide" data-parent="grp_meta_description" data-fille="aide_meta_description"><span class="bold colorblack">?</span></button> + </div> + </div> + <div class="editer-groupe grp_texte_marianne"> + <div class="editer editer_texte_marianne obligatoire saisie_textarea editer_even"> + <label class="editer-label" for="champ_texte_marianne">Texte de la Marianne<span class="obligatoire"></span></label> + <textarea name="texte_marianne_#CONFIG_VALUE{langue_2}" id="champ_texte_marianne_#CONFIG_VALUE{langue_2}" rows="4" cols="33" placeholder="Champ obligatoire. Saisir le nom de l'institution qui doit apparaître sous la Marianne">#CONFIG_VALUE{texte_marianne_#CONFIG_VALUE{langue_2}}</textarea> + <button class="liste_de_lien questionmark_header" type="button" title="Afficher la fenêtre d'aide" data-parent="grp_texte_marianne" data-fille="aide_texte_marianne"><span class="bold colorblack">?</span></button> + </div> + </div> </div> + [(#CONFIG_VALUE{nombre_de_langue}|>{2}|oui) + <div id="tabpanel-3" role="tabpanel" tabindex="0" aria-labelledby="tab-3" class="is-hidden"> + <p> + Ida Henriette da Fonseca (July 27, 1802 – July 6, 1858) was a Danish opera singer and composer. + Ida Henriette da Fonseca was the daughter of Abraham da Fonseca (1776–1849) and Marie Sofie Kiærskou (1784–1863). + She and her sister Emilie da Fonseca were students of Giuseppe Siboni, choir master of the Opera in Copenhagen. + She was given a place at the royal Opera alongside her sister the same year she debuted in 1827. + </p> + </div> + ] + [(#CONFIG_VALUE{nombre_de_langue}|>{3}|oui) + <div id="tabpanel-4" role="tabpanel" tabindex="0" aria-labelledby="tab-4" class="is-hidden"> + <p> + Peter Erasmus Lange-Müller (1 December 1850 – 26 February 1926) was a Danish composer and pianist. + His compositional style was influenced by Danish folk music and by the work of Robert Schumann; Johannes Brahms; and his Danish countrymen, including J.P.E. Hartmann. + </p> + </div> + ] </div> ] ] @@ -1144,12 +1165,6 @@ #SET{nombre_de_liens_ecosysteme, #CONST{_MAX_NOMBRE_DE_LIENS_ECOSYSTEME}} <input type="hidden" name="nombre_de_liens_ecosysteme" value="#GET{nombre_de_liens_ecosysteme}" /> </li> - <li> - <div class="editer editer_description_footer saisie_textarea editer_odd"> - <label class="editer-label" for="champ_description_footer">Description Footer</label> - <textarea name="description_footer" class="" id="champ_description_footer" rows="6" cols="33" placeholder="Saisir le texte de description qui doit apparaître dans le footer">#CONFIG_VALUE{description_footer}</textarea> - </div> - </li> <li> <ul class="gestion_nombre_de_liens_ecosysteme form_configuration"> #SET{nombre_de_liens_ecosysteme, #CONFIG_VALUE{nombre_de_liens_ecosysteme}} @@ -1163,8 +1178,15 @@ </li> </BOUCLE_afficher_nombre_de_liens_ecosysteme> </ul> + </li> + <li><h3 class="topPadding1">Environnement « Description »</h3></li> + <li> + <div class="editer editer_description_footer saisie_textarea editer_odd"> + <label class="editer-label" for="champ_description_footer">Description Footer</label> + <textarea name="description_footer" class="" id="champ_description_footer" rows="6" cols="33" placeholder="Saisir le texte de description qui doit apparaître dans le footer">#CONFIG_VALUE{description_footer}</textarea> + </div> </li> - <li > + <li> <h3 class="topPadding1">Environnement « Licence »</h3> </li> <li> diff --git a/design_system_admin/prive/css/dsfrconfiguration.css b/design_system_admin/prive/css/dsfrconfiguration.css index b3a5864..0e88238 100644 --- a/design_system_admin/prive/css/dsfrconfiguration.css +++ b/design_system_admin/prive/css/dsfrconfiguration.css @@ -720,4 +720,8 @@ label{ [role="tabpanel"] p { margin: 0; } - \ No newline at end of file + .focus{ + display: flex !important; + align-items: center; + } + .focus img{ margin-right: 5px;} \ No newline at end of file -- GitLab